This way easier vocab words will be reviewed less and less often. In a Space Repetition algorithm, you would review a new word every so often, but after each successfull recall, the algorithm lengthens the duration between now and the next review. To solve the problem, you can use Spaced Repetition to remember vocab words for as long as you review them. But more often than not, most people just review their vocab list a few times and ending up forgetting them after a test. Well, you probably know that you have to review this word to commit it to long-term memory. A German psychologist Hermann Ebbinghaus conducted experiments to figure out just how rapidly the brain forgets. Human brains are quick to forget new information. This method does not work, as you would have guessed. Naturally you repeat this word in your mind many times in a short interval and hope that you would still remember it later. Say you learned a new word and you want to make sure that you won’t forget about it. Spaced Repetition is a memorization technique specifically designed to maximize long-term retention with minimum effort.
